17-209: DISCONTINUANCE OF SERVICE; NOTICE:
   A.   Whenever the owner or occupant of any premises connected with the water system desires to discontinue the use of water, he shall notify the authority in writing, unless otherwise approved by the authority, and thereupon the authority shall disconnect the premises concerning which notice of discontinuance has been given.
   B.   It is unlawful for any owner of any premises connected with the water supply system to disconnect the water on the premises unless he shall have first filed a written request that the service of water to the premises be discontinued, and shall pay all arrearages on water rates on the premises.
   C.   When the water has been shut off from any premises upon application of the owner or occupant of the premises or for nonpayment of water charges, or for any other cause, it is unlawful for any person to again connect such premises with water except upon application to and by the authority.
